Recently while in Kenya I found out what a Hyrax is, and why they are evil and not to be slept near. A Hyrax is a small rodent looking thing that is actually related to the elephant with little small tusks.

Now here is why I call these cute unique animals evil, they have a tendency to scream at about 160 decibels from 10pm to 5am sounding like someone is being murdered. I did not get any sleep the two nights I had one near where I was sleeping. These critters were more alarming than lions roaring, hyenas evil laughing or jackals barking in Kenya at night.

So I present for your listening displeasure my iPhone recording of the Hyrax at 2am. I wanted to make him into a nice spicy little stew.
